What is 288/592 simplified as a fraction?
288/592 in simplest form is 18/37.

step 1 Observe the input parameters and what to be found:
Input values:
Fraction = 288/592
what to be found:
288/592 = ?
Reduce 288/592 in lowest terms.
step 2 Find the prime factors of the numerator of given fraction 288/592.
Prime factors of 288 = 2 x 2 x 2 x 2 x 2 x 3 x 3
step 3 Find the prime factors of the denominator of given fraction 288/592.
Prime factors of 592 = 2 x 2 x 2 x 2 x 37
step 4 Rewrite the fraction 288/592 in the form of prime factors as like the below:
288/592= (2 x 2 x 2 x 2 x 2 x 3 x 3) / (2 x 2 x 2 x 2 x 37)
step 5 Check and reduce the factors of 288 and 592 if any factors in the numerator and denominator cancel each other:
= (2 x 2 x 2 x 2 x 2 x 3 x 3) / (2 x 2 x 2 x 2 x 37)
= ( 2 x 3 x 3)/( 37)
288/592 = 18/37
Hence,
288/592 in simplest form is 18/37.
